The Thermal Master P4 utilizes advanced thermal imaging technology that leverages two distinct lenses to enhance image clarity and detail. This dual-lens setup allows for more accurate thermal readings, making it effective in identifying temperature variations in various environments. It operates on a high-resolution sensor that captures thermal radiation, converting it into visible images, thus enabling users to see in complete darkness. The integration with smartphones allows for seamless viewing and sharing of thermal images, enhancing its utility for diverse applications.
